高性能Linux加速机器学习实战
|
在当今数据驱动的世界里,机器学习已经成为推动技术进步的重要力量。而Linux作为一款强大且灵活的操作系统,为高性能计算提供了坚实的基础。作为一名科技站长,我深知如何利用Linux来加速机器学习任务。 选择合适的硬件配置是关键。多核CPU、高速SSD以及GPU加速卡的组合能够显著提升训练速度。在Linux环境下,通过内核参数优化和驱动程序的正确安装,可以充分发挥硬件潜力。 软件层面同样不可忽视。使用如CUDA、cuDNN等工具包,可以让深度学习框架如TensorFlow或PyTorch更好地利用GPU资源。同时,合理配置环境变量和路径,确保所有组件协同工作无阻。 监控与调优也是不可或缺的一环。借助top、htop、nvidia-smi等工具,可以实时观察系统负载和资源使用情况。根据实际表现调整进程优先级或内存分配,有助于提高整体效率。 容器化技术如Docker也为机器学习部署带来了便利。通过构建标准化的镜像,不仅简化了环境配置,还能保证不同节点间的一致性,便于大规模分布式训练。
AI渲染图,仅供参考 持续学习和实践是提升能力的关键。关注社区动态、参与开源项目、阅读相关文档,都能帮助我们不断优化自己的机器学习工作流。(编辑:92站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

